VOOG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

576 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ard S&P 500 Growth ETF (VOOG)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$4.37B — up 24% from $3.52B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 106 funds opened new VOOG positions and 26 closed out — a net gain of 80 holders — while 191 added to existing stakes and 135 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Focus Partners Wealth, adding an estimated $42.5M. The largest seller was Connecticut Wealth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$23.2M sold.
